Bean Anthracnose (Colletotrichum torulosum)
Colletotrichum torulosum
Description
The fungus Colletotrichum torulosum is a significant plant pathogen known for causing anthracnose in various leguminous crops. It belongs to the Ascomycota division and is recognized by plant pathologists for its ability to cause severe damage to stems, pods, and leaves in pulse crops, particularly lupines.
The primary symptoms of infection include dark, sunken lesions appearing on stems and petioles. As the disease progresses, these lesions may expand and coalesce, leading to stem breakage and stunted growth. Infected pods often show reddish-brown or black spots, which can lead to seed rot and reduced germination rates.
The disease thrives under conditions of high humidity, frequent rainfall, and moderate temperatures. It is primarily disseminated through contaminated seeds, infested crop residues left in the field, and the movement of spores via wind or water splash. Once established, the fungus can survive in the soil or on debris for multiple seasons.
The economic impact of Colletotrichum torulosum is substantial, as it can cause significant yield losses and degrade the quality of harvested grains. In severe cases, the disease can compromise the entire crop population, resulting in complete field failure if environmental conditions are conducive to fungal spread.
- Sourcing and planting certified disease-free seeds.
- Implementation of a rigorous crop rotation program (at least 3-4 years).
- Deep plowing to bury crop residues that harbor the pathogen.
- Application of appropriate fungicides during the flowering and pod-filling stages.
Integrated pest management (IPM) is the most effective approach for controlling this pathogen. By combining cultural practices, such as proper sanitation and variety selection, with targeted chemical interventions, growers can mitigate the risk of anthracnose and ensure stable production of leguminous crops.
